function onTerm(data) {
log("term");
- queue("termlists").publish(data);
+ queue("facets").publish(data);
}
function onShow(data, teamName) {
params.onstat = onStat;
log("setting stat callback");
}
- if (m_queues.termlists && config.facets.length) {
+ if (m_queues.facets && config.facets.length) {
params.onterm = onTerm;
log("setting term callback");
}
that.registerTemplate = function(name, text) {
+ if(mkws._old2new.hasOwnProperty(name)) {
+ mkws.log("Warning: registerTemplate old widget name: " + name + " => " + mkws._old2new[name]);
+ name = mkws._old2new[name];
+ }
m_templateText[name] = text;
};
function loadTemplate(name, fallbackString) {
+ if(mkws._old2new.hasOwnProperty(name)) {
+ mkws.log("Warning loadTemplate: old widget name: " + name + " => " + mkws._old2new[name]);
+ name = mkws._old2new[name];
+ }
+
var template = m_template[name];
if (template === undefined && Handlebars.compile) {
var source;
if (node && node.length < 1) {
node = $(".mkws-template-" + name);
}
- if (node && node.length < 1) {
- node = $(".mkws-template_" + name + " .mkws-team-" + that.name());
- }
- if (node && node.length < 1) {
- node = $(".mkws-template_" + name);
- }
if (node) source = node.html();
if (!source) source = m_templateText[name];
if (source) {